Description

A kind of abutting formula heat shrink films cutting mechanism
Technical field
The utility model relates to a kind of abutting formula heat shrink films cutting mechanisms.
Background technique
Heat shrink films are carried out according to the requirement of client currently, heat shrink films are typically necessary after processing preparation is completed Cutting on width, or heat shrink films are divided into multistage, how fast easily to adjust the position of cutter in cutter device It is set to the developing focus for the utility model.
Utility model content
In view of the deficiencies of the prior art mentioned above, the utility model solves the problems, such as are as follows: it is convenient, even to provide a kind of adjusting Connect firm abutting formula heat shrink films cutting mechanism.
To solve the above problems, the technical solution that the utility model is taken is as follows:
A kind of abutting formula heat shrink films cutting mechanism, including connecting rod, sliding shoe, compress mechanism, cutter, joining threaded hole Bar;Multiple sliding shoes are slidably socketed in the connecting rod;The sliding shoe, which passes through one respectively and compresses mechanism, is mounted on company On extension bar;The bottom of the sliding shoe is installed by cutter;The sliding shoe is equipped with the through slot through its two sides;Described Sliding shoe is socketed in connecting rod by through slot;The mechanism that compresses includes catch bar, press block, driving elastomer;It is described Catch bar lower end from the upper end of sliding shoe insertion sliding shoe through slot in;The lower end of the catch bar is installed by press block; Multiple driving elastomers are installed between the upper inner wall of the press block upper surface and through slot;The driving elastomer elastic force drives Dynamic press block is pressed on downwards on the upper surface of connecting rod;The both ends of the connecting rod are equipped with guide plate;The sliding shoe Through slot two sides be equipped with guide groove;The guide plate slides of the connecting rod are plugged in the guide groove of sliding shoe through slot;It is described The upper end two sides of sliding shoe be respectively equipped with an abutting thread groove;The abutting thread groove of the upper end two sides of the sliding shoe point Not be connected to the guide groove of the through slot two sides of sliding shoe;The abutting thread groove is located at the upper end of guide groove;The abutting Screw thread installs an abutting screw rod respectively in thread groove;The lower end of the abutting screw rod is pressed on guide plate upper end.
Further, the upper end of the connecting rod is equipped with and compresses protrusion;The lower end surface of the press block is equipped with for pressure tank; The press block is compressed by for pressure tank of lower end surface is connected to the compressing in protrusion of connecting rod upper end.
Further, the section of the connecting rod is in up big and down small trapezium structure.
Further, the through slot bottom of the sliding shoe is equipped with sliding groove;The lower end of the connecting rod is mounted on sliding In the sliding groove of block through slot bottom.
Further, the press block is in up-small and down-big trapezium structure.
The beneficial effects of the utility model
The abutting thread groove of the upper end two sides of the utility model sliding shoe guide groove with the through slot two sides of sliding shoe respectively Connection will abut the abutting screw rod of thread groove internal screw thread installation, and the lower end for abutting screw rod is pressed on guide plate upper end, to realize The positioning of sliding shoe and connecting rod;The utility model by lifting catch bar directly up, so that press block is disconnected bar, so Sliding shoe is fitted in connecting rod afterwards and is moved, to adjust the position of cutter, adjusting is directly put down after finishing and pushed away Lever pushes press block to down spring using driving elastomer, is pressed in connecting rod so that compressing plate, to realize sliding shoe Positioning in connecting rod, it is very convenient to adjust.
